Citation:
M. Farnsworth, T. Tomiyama, Capturing, classification and concept generation for automated maintenance tasks, CIRP Annals - Manufacturing Technology, Volume 63, Issue 1, 2014, Pages 149-152
Abstract:
Maintenance is an efficient and cost effective way to keep the function of the product available during the product lifecycle. Automating maintenance may drive down costs and improve performance time; however capturing the necessary information required to perform certain maintenance tasks and later building automated platforms to undertake them is very difficult. This paper looks at the creation of a novel methodology tasked with firstly the capture and classification of maintenance tasks and finally conceptual design of platforms for automating maintenance.
